Germany - Export of Reaction Engines Other Than Turbo Jets
Since 2014, Germany Export of Reaction Engines Other Than Turbo Jets fell by 13.2% year on year. At $9,769,864.56 in 2019, the country was ranked number 5 among other countries in Export of Reaction Engines Other Than Turbo Jets. Germany is overtaken by Spain, which was ranked number 4 with $14,669,333.48 and is followed by United Kingdom with $5,650,954.98. Russia lead the ranking with $302,564,468.32 in 2019, that is +5.1% versus 2018. United Arab Emirates witnessed the best average annual growth at +513.6% per year, while Poland witnessed the worst performance at -86.4% per year.
